Mudjacking Process Overview

Addressing sunken or uneven concrete surfaces commonly requires the mudjacking process, an exceptionally reliable technique for leveling. This process involves drilling small openings into the damaged concrete slab and pumping a mixture of water, soil, and cement underneath it. As the material is pumped in, it fills voids and raises the slab to its original position. Mudjacking is favored for its cost-effectiveness and speed, allowing for quick repairs with minimal disruption. It is especially beneficial for patios, driveways, and sidewalks, where uneven surfaces may create safety risks. By rebuilding structural integrity and boosting visual appeal, mudjacking not only maximizes the usability of concrete surfaces but also increases their durability, making it a preferred solution among homeowners and contractors alike.

Advantages of Polyurethane Injection

Polyurethane injection stands out as a contemporary method for correcting unlevel concrete areas, providing significant benefits compared to older approaches including mudjacking. This technique involves injecting a light polyurethane foam material below the concrete, that expands to fill existing voids, efficiently elevating the concrete surface. A notable benefit is its fast curing period, frequently enabling use in a matter of hours, limiting interference to daily activities. Moreover, polyurethane foam demonstrates excellent water resistance, reducing the risk of future settling. The injection method is notably less disruptive, necessitating minimal drilling holes and leading to less damage to the surrounding area. Additionally, the lightweight composition of polyurethane avoids placing extra pressure on the underlying soil, providing lasting solutions for multiple types of concrete surfaces. Overall, polyurethane injection provides an efficient, durable, and effective concrete leveling solution.

Application of Self-Leveling Compound

Attaining a seamless, uniform surface with a self-leveling compound necessitates meticulous preparation and application techniques. First, the underlying concrete surface must be completely cleaned to clear away debris, dust, and grease. Once confirmed the surface is dry, any cracks should be filled and primed to improve overall adhesion. Mixing the self-leveling compound according to the manufacturer's guidelines is critical; proper consistency guarantees ideal flow. Applying اعثر على الدليل the compound in a steady manner and using a gauge rake can help spread it uniformly. It is important to work quickly, as self-leveling compounds harden quickly. Lastly, permitting the compound to fully harden before applying any flooring material ensures a sturdy and perfect foundation.

How to Know When Concrete Leveling Becomes Necessary

Uneven concrete areas can appear in a number of ways, signaling the need for leveling. Residents may detect cracks, separations, or shifting in driveways, sidewalks, or outdoor patio areas. Standing water collecting in certain spots instead of draining properly is a telltale sign of an underlying problem. Additionally, heaved or lifted slabs can generate serious tripping risks, endangering both homeowners and their guests.

Within basements or garages, uneven flooring can cause issues with installed fixtures or appliances, affecting their functionality. Inspecting for visible signs, such as sloped surfaces or separation between slabs, is absolutely necessary. In addition, doors and windows might stick or not close correctly because of foundation movement.

Routine evaluations of interior and exterior concrete can help detect these warning signs at an early stage. Tackling these problems without delay secures enduring structural soundness and enhances the overall safety and aesthetic appeal of the structure.

Leveling Method Types

When deciding on a leveling approach, it is essential to evaluate the unique demands of the job, as different methods offer distinct advantages and limitations. Common methods include mud jacking, where a cement mixture is pumped under slabs to raise them, and polyurethane foam injection, which offers a lightweight, fast-setting alternative. Furthermore, grinding removes elevated areas to establish an even surface, while screeding is employed on fresh concrete to achieve a uniform finish. Each method varies in cost, time efficiency, and suitability for different types of surface issues. In the end, determining the right leveling method hinges on factors like the extent of the problem, environmental conditions, and the desired longevity of the repair, ensuring optimal outcomes for any concrete leveling endeavor.

What You Should Do After Leveling Your Concrete Surface

After leveling a concrete surface, the subsequent steps are essential for ensuring durability and aesthetics. First, it is essential to allow adequate curing time. In most cases, this duration extends from 24 hours to a few days, based on the specific leveling compound applied. During this phase, keeping the surface moist can prevent cracking and enhance strength.

After curing, sealing the surface is recommended to protect against stains, moisture, and wear. A high-quality concrete sealer can extend the lifespan of the surface. Additionally, adding a finish, such as an epoxy coating or paint, can improve the appearance and performance of the concrete.

Regular maintenance, including cleaning and inspections, is critical to identify and address any potential issues early. Furthermore, refraining from heavy use of the newly leveled surface for a week or beyond can help sustain its durability, making certain that the effects of the leveling process continue to hold up for years down the line.

What Are the Fees Related to Concrete Leveling?

Prices for concrete leveling generally fall from $2 to $10 per square foot, influenced by factors including the extent of the damage, materials utilized, and regional labor costs. Extra costs can result from prep work or equipment fees.
